This is just coincidence that I end up answering your questions but a response is a response. If this makes you feel any better, I'm flying out of Kitts and into Kitts on Sept. 3rd. I plan to get a lot of luggage with me on the way back. I can fairly say that there isn't a limit on the number of luggage you bring along or even weight. I don't think you'll have much of a problem except for the fact that you have to carry them onto the ferry. Then the school bus driver will meet you at the ferry station in downtown and drive you to your place. The only trouble will be getting everything in a bus on Kitts and onto the ferry. Otherwise you're good to go. I would advise you though to fly straight into Nevis. This is your first trip to the island and the last thing I'd want is for you to have it tough after a long flight. PM me if you still get in to Kitts and I'll try to see if my friend can pick you up from the airport and help you to the ferrry. Again, I would rather you pay a couple extra bucks and fly straight in, at least for your first trip. Let me know what you decide and get pumped up for a great experience. See ya soon.

Hope all is well. As for internet service on the island, we get a really good connection now and it's really fast but you have to sign up before August 30th to get the good deal. So make sure when you get on the island to set up your internet. It will cost you around $125 for the first month because you have to buy the modem from them and $40-$50 each month after that. As far as regular phone service, I would suggest you get Vonage. It's free to the US and Canada and it's been working miracles for me. It's honestly the best thing you can have here.
